MY ATTORNEY

After living what I felt was a "decent" life, my time on earth came to the
end. The first thing I remember is sitting on a bench in the waiting room of
what I thought to be a courthouse. The doors opened and I was instructed to
come in and have a seat by the defense table.
As I looked around I saw the "prosecutor." He was a villainous looking gent
who snarled as he stared at me. He definitely was the most evil person I
have ever seen. I sat down and looked to my left and there sat My Attorney,
a kind and gentle looking man whose appearance seemed so familiar to me, I
felt I knew Him.
The corner door flew open and there appeared the Judge in full flowing
robes. He commanded an awesome presence as He moved across the room. I
couldn't take my eyes off of Him. As He took His seat behind the bench, He
said, "Let us begin."
The prosecutor rose and said, "My name is Satan and I am here to show you
why this man belongs in hell." He proceeded to tell of lies I told, things I
stole, and in the past when I cheated others. Satan told of other horrible
perversions once in my life and the more he spoke, the further down in my
seat I sank. I was so embarrassed, I couldn't look at anyone, even my own
Attorney, as the Devil told of sins even I completely forgotten about. As
upset as I was at Satan for telling all these things about me, I was equally
upset at My Attorney who sat there silently not offering any form of defense
at all. I know I was guilty of those things, but I did some good in my
life - couldn't that at least equal out part of the harm I'd done?
Satan finished with a fury and said, "This man belongs in hell, he is guilty
of all I have charged and there is not a person who can prove otherwise."
When it was His turn, My Attorney first asked if He might approach the
bench. The Judge allowed this over the strong objection of Satan, and
beckoned Him to come forward. As He got up and started walking, I was able
to see Him in His full splendor and majesty. I realized why He seemed so
familiar; this was Jesus representing me, my Lord and my Savior.
He stopped at the bench and softly said to the Judge, "Hi, Dad," then He
turned to address the court. "Satan was correct in saying this man sinned, I
won't deny any of these allegations. And, yes, the wage of sin is death, and
this man deserves to be punished."
Jesus took a deep breath and turned to His Father with outstretched arms and
proclaimed, "However, I died on the cross so this person might have eternal
life and he accepted Me as his Savior, so he is Mine."
My Lord continued with, "His name is written in the Book of Life and no one
can snatch him from Me. Satan still does not understand yet. This man is not
to be given justice, but rather mercy."
As Jesus sat down, He quietly paused, looked at His Father and said,"There
is nothing else that needs to be done. I've done it all."
The Judge lifted His mighty hand and slammed the gavel down. The
following words bellowed from His lips... "This man is free The penalty
for him was already paid in full. Case dismissed"
As my Lord led me away, I could hear Satan ranting and raving, "I won't give
up, I will win the next one."
I asked Jesus as He gave me my instructions where to go next, "Have you ever
lost a case?" Christ lovingly smiled and said, "Everyone that comes to Me
and asked Me to represent them, received the same verdict as you, "PAID IN
FULL."

One day a father of a very wealthy family took his son on a trip to the
country with the firm purpose of showing his son how poor people live.

They spent a couple of days and nights on the farm of what would be
considered a very poor family.

On their return from their trip, the father asked his son, "How was the
trip?"

"It was great, Dad."
"Did you see how poor people live?" the father asked.

"Oh yes," said the son.

"So, tell me, what did you learn from the trip?" asked the father.

The son answered: "I saw that we


have one dog and they had four.

We have a pool that reaches to the middle of our garden and they have a
river that has no end.

We have imported lanterns in our garden and they have the stars at night.

Our patio reaches to the front yard and they have the whole horizon.

We have a small piece of land to live on and they have fields that go
beyond our sight.

We have servants who serve us, but they serve others.

We buy our food, but they grow theirs.


We have walls around our property to protect us, they have friends to
protect them."

The boy's father was speechless.

Then his son added, "Thanks, Dad, for showing me how poor we are."



Isn't perspective a wonderful thing? Makes you wonder ..........ours or God's.
